What is American Future Fuel EV-to-EBIT?

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, American Future Fuel's Enterprise Value is $21.11 Mil. American Future Fuel's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 was $-3.30 Mil. Therefore, American Future Fuel's EV-to-EBIT for today is -6.40.

American Future Fuel  (OTCPK:AFFCF)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

American Future Fuel Corp is a Canada based company. The Company's business is to acquire, explore, and develop interests in mining projects. The Company has one operating segment, mineral exploration and development.
